在编写odps sql 如何获取当前时间,odps sql 有获取当前时间的函数吗?
你要的是这个? https://help.aliyun.com/document_detail/27864.html
>select getdate() from dual;
+------------+
| _c0 |
+------------+
| 2016-10-14 09:25:35 |
+------------+
GETDATE
函数声明:
datetime getdate()
用途:获取当前系统时间。使用东八区时间作为MaxCompute标准时间。
返回值:返回当前日期和时间,datetime类型。
备注:
在一个MaxCompute SQL任务中(以分布式方式执行),getdate总是返回一个固定的值。返回结果会是MaxCompute SQL执行期间的任意时间,时间精度精确到秒。
为什么加不加project名字获取不到呢?
select getdate() from My_First_MaxCompute.dual;
select getdate() from dual;
是2.0有变化吗?
可以在Meta中,查UDF的
有的project下,dual前面要加上project的名字
有的没有dual表的,可以在前面加上project
时间函数可以在UDF中查
版权声明:本文内容由阿里云实名注册用户自发贡献,版权归原作者所有,阿里云开发者社区不拥有其著作权,亦不承担相应法律责任。具体规则请查看《阿里云开发者社区用户服务协议》和《阿里云开发者社区知识产权保护指引》。如果您发现本社区中有涉嫌抄袭的内容,填写侵权投诉表单进行举报,一经查实,本社区将立刻删除涉嫌侵权内容。